GTA Realtors® Release Mid-October Resale Figures

TORONTO, October 16, 2013 – Greater Toronto Area REALTORS® reported 3,460 sales through the TorontoMLS system during the first 14 days of October 2013. This result was up by 21 per cent in comparison to 2,849 sales reported during the same period in 2012. October mid-month sales were also up by 13 per cent compared…

GTA Realtors® Release Rental Market Report

TORONTO, October 16, 2013 – Greater Toronto Area REALTORS® reported 6,541 condominium apartments rented through the TorontoMLS system in the third quarter of 2013. This result was up by 25 per cent in comparison to the third quarter of 2012. The number of condominium apartments listed for rent on the TorontoMLS system during the third…

GTA Realtors® Release September Housing Figures

TORONTO, October 3, 2013 – Greater Toronto Area REALTORS® reported 7,411 residential sales through the TorontoMLS system in September 2013, representing a 30 per cent increase compared to 5,687 transactions reported in September 2012. Year-to-date, total residential sales reported through TorontoMLS amounted to 68,907 during the first nine months of 2013 – down by one…
